    Great Video, I have couple of questions. 1 - Can you take the caliper brackets off without taking the caliper off so less work but also don't have to push the brake piston back in? 2 - I don't have a bucket of bolts, do you know what size of bolt I can use for my 2007 Rav4 Limited in the holes to pull the rotor off the hub? Thank you.

    • @seabassvlogs3011
      @seabassvlogs3011 3 ปีที่แล้ว

      1) Yes, I’ve done it before it’ll just a tight squeeze back on.
      2) Use a Hammer just be carful not to smash the actual rotor and just hit it on the face where the wheel mounts. It’ll definitely take longer but if you wanted to just get the bolts i think they are M8x1.25.

    Hey thanks for this I just replaced my front wheel hub bearings in the front first time ever great experience I got lucky no rust everything came off easy 2013 rav 4 thank you. Anytime I tend to take my tire off and put it back on there's a rattling noise the tire place in my neighborhood put their hand through my rim one time and did something with the plate to make it stop making noise I wonder what they did does anybody have any insight on this? Sounds like a light grinding noise I know that I put everything in together fine..

    • @Jeremy.v
      @Jeremy.v 3 ปีที่แล้ว +1

      Bent backing plate. They bent it back into place slightly so it’s not rubbing on the disc

    • @Jeremy.v
      @Jeremy.v 3 ปีที่แล้ว

      Shaq Milb I’m assuming when you take the tyre off you are hooking the backing plate somehow bending it causing it to rub on the disc
